[0002] Existing light sources generally use traditional incandescent lamps or fluorescent energy-saving lamps; these traditional light sources have the following disadvantages: high power consumption, high temperature, poor safety performance, unsatisfactory light efficiency, slow start-up speed, and short life Wait
However, the chips of high-power light-emitting diodes will generate high heat when they work. If the heat is not dissipated in time, it will have a great impact on its performance and even its service life.
[0004] The existing LED three-proof bracket lights generally have waterproof, dustproof and anti-corrosion properties, and are mostly used in high-end office buildings, offices, large shopping malls, waiting buildings, factories, schools, hospitals and other indoor public places; however, currently on the market The LED three-proof bracket, but there are still the following shortcomings: (1) LED light source and power supply, there is no independent LED light source card slot and power card slot in the tube body, which causes some inconvenience to the installation; moreover, the LED light source And the power supply is in the tube body, it is easy to shake due to looseness, which is not conducive to transportation and lamp connection, and even affects the stability of the product; (2) The traditional end cap structure is still used at both ends of the tube body, and no waterproof measures are added , is easy to enter water, so its waterproof effect is poor; moreover, the connection between the end cover and the end of the pipe body is not fixed with screws, so the connection between the two is not firm; (3) the pipe body (i.e.: the main body), the frame body and the transparent cover are independent accessories, which are processed and formed separately. During installation, the two need to be spliced ​​together to form the pipe body. The main body of this non-integrated structure is prone to splicing due to existing Insufficient waterproofness, light leakage, etc. due to gaps, and the overall strength of the main body formed by such splicing is not enough

The invention discloses an improved structure of an LED three-proofing support lamp. The improved structure comprises a main body, a driving power source, an LED module, end covers and waterproof plugs. The main body comprises a frame body and a transparent cover. The two ends of the main body are provided with the end covers and the waterproof plugs respectively. The transparent cover and the frame body are integrally formed in an extruded mode. The main body is further provided with an LED module clamping groove and a driving power source clamping groove which are used for clamping the LED module and the driving power source respectively. According to the improved structure of the LED three-proofing support lamp, the main body integrally formed in the extruded mode is internally provided with the LED module clamping groove and the driving power source clamping groove so that the LED module and the driving power source can be mounted conveniently, the production efficiency can be improved, and the LED module and the driving power source can be firmly and stable stably mounted in the main body and, is not prone to shaking and is stable in operation; besides, the transparent cover and the frame body are integrally formed in an extruded mode, the strength and the insulating performance of the transparent cover and the frame body are improved, and good watertightness is achieved, is simple and reasonable in structure and especially applicable to office buildings, offices, superstores, waiting halls, factories, schools, hospitals and other indoor public places.

technical field [0001] The invention relates to the technical field of lighting appliances, in particular to an improved structure of an LED three-proof bracket lamp. Background technique [0002] Existing light sources generally use traditional incandescent lamps or fluorescent energy-saving lamps; these traditional light sources have the following disadvantages: high power consumption, high temperature, poor safety performance, unsatisfactory light efficiency, slow start-up speed, and short life Wait. [0003] With the rapid development of science and technology, high-power light-emitting diodes, High Power LEDs, have been continuously improved and widely used as decorative and lighting sources. High-power light-emitting diodes are clean and green environmental protection light sources, and are increasingly valued and accepted by people; At present, light source products are mainly used in home lighting, commercial store decoration and other places.
